Description

I installed Guest Additions on the Windows Guest, created a shared folder, connected it as a network drive in Windows Guest.

The shared folder works, I can read and write to it from the guest, and browse it with Windows Explorer, however:

  • most applications show it with a red "X" on it as if it was not accessible
  • many application will be able to open, browse, read from and write to it despite showing the red X
  • SOME applications will instead refuse to open the network drive and give an "access denied" error. For example you can't open an HTML file residing on the network drive with Internet Explorer
  • .air packages (installation packages for adobe AIR) won't install if run from the shared folder (you have to copy them to the virtual disk, then they will work). The air will run from the network drive, but when it is supposed to ask for confirmation to switch to admin privileges, istead of popping the dialog, it will output an error message and abort installation

The last issue is indeed a special case of the previous one: AIR installer cannot handle properly the .air file residing on the network drive.

There seems to be a privilege issue with shared folders.

Host: Ubuntu 10.04 32bit Guest Windows 7 64bit
